Output 51a1424eb79e755c1431631c79336b50933568c15fa1e8ef6f934b8df1280552:0

value
66294
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f6c62587bdd4b8cda5c22d1b845171464c05654 OP_EQUALVERIFY OP_CHECKSIG
address
1FXxHAYywkHPHwY7B83Q3B8kdbXt24AMwt
transaction
51a1424eb79e755c1431631c79336b50933568c15fa1e8ef6f934b8df1280552
spent
true